The second ingredient to get sales through Google is owning a page with keywords that match the user’s search.
The majority of the matching process is driven by keywords in the page title (keywords in the URL, images, and page text merely support the title). Google will have a difficult time matching a page called “Zach & Amber Wedding” with a search for “good Hilton wedding photographers,” even though they might be related. Therefore, page titles with specific information have a better chance of ranking.
The more unique titles you have on your website, the more chances you have to be matched with a searcher.
